Description For Mid-Level C#.Net Software Engineer Developer

The Boeing Company is seeking a Mid-Level Software Engineer - Developer to join their Government Vehicle Health Management Systems (GVHMS) team in Hazelwood, Missouri. This role is part of the Boeing Global Services (BGS) Software Engineering organization, focusing on developing and supporting product support systems for aircraft platforms.

The position involves working on the Maintenance Management System (MMS), which manages aircraft health and usage data, performs assessments, and recommends maintenance actions. The ideal candidate will be developing cloud-based, micro-service applications using Continuous Integration/Continuous Deployment (CI/CD) pipelines in an agile environment.

This is an excellent opportunity for a software engineer with strong C#/.NET experience to work on mission-critical systems in the aerospace industry. The role offers competitive compensation ($107,100 - $144,900) and comprehensive benefits including health insurance, retirement plans, and more.

Key technical requirements include 5 years of experience in software frameworks, object-oriented design, and C#/ASP.NET. Preferred qualifications include experience with .NET Core, microservices, containerization (Docker, Kubernetes), and cloud platforms like Azure and AWS.

The position requires U.S. citizenship and the ability to obtain a Secret clearance. The role is 100% onsite in Hazelwood, MO, and includes working in a drug-free workplace with regular testing policies.
